Product description/Ingredients

Description and Ingredients of Yves Rocher Raspberry Peppermint Exfoliating Shower Gel

Our Panel of experts, unique since 1959, have selected and combined Peppermint essential oil (in the fragrance), a Raspberry extract and fruit seeds for the pleasure of clean and gently exfoliated skin daily.

  • 100% fruit seed scrubs: Apricot kernel powder and Kiwi seeds
  • This formula contains more than 96% ingredients from natural origin
  • Easily biodegradable formula
  • Eco-friendly tube made from 25% less plastic than the previous one
  • Paraben free

Aqua/Water/Eau, Ammonium Lauryl Sulfate, Decyl Glucoside, Acrylates Crosspolymer-4, Cocamidopropyl Betaine, Aloe Barbadensis Leaf Juice, Parfum/Fragrance, Cocamide Mipa, Citric Acid, Prunus Armeniaca (Apricot) Seed Powder, Sodium Benzoate, Actinidia Chinensis (Kiwi), Tetrasodium EDTA, Glycerin, Sodium Hydroxide, Limonene, Salicylic Acid, BHT, Rubus Idaeus (Raspberry) Fruit Extract, Methylpropanediol, Potassium Sorbate, Denatonium Benzoate, CI 17200(RED 33), CI 19140 (YELLOW 5)

Packaging, Texture and Consistency

The Yves Rocher Raspberry Peppermint Exfoliating Shower Gel comes in a 200ml eco-friendly tube with a plastic flip top cap.

It is also transparent so you can actually see the exfoliants (Apricot kernel powder and kiwi seeds) which in my opinion makes the packaging prettier.

The product has a light red colour (which you can’t see clearly because of the lighting) with a gel-like texture to it. It is neither too viscous nor too light.

My Experience with the Yves Rocher Raspberry Peppermint Exfoliating Shower Gel

This product happens to be my first exposure to this Yves Rocher brand and so at the time I got it, I did a little research on the brand. It is a French luxury brand that offers a wide range of plant-based skincare, cosmetics and perfumes. They are one of the few brands that are very intentional about their manufacturing process, making sure it doesn’t impact the environment negatively and I love them for that.

Also, if you know me, you’d know I really like scented body products and this product really made me happy in that aspect. I love how they were able to subtly add the peppermint scent while maintaining the fruitiness of raspberries. It leaves my entire space smelling beautifully and somehow gives me a feeling of luxury.

The Yves Rocher Raspberry Peppermint Exfoliating Shower Gel lathers pretty well too, with a little going a long way. Also, after rinsing the lather off, I love how refreshed my skin looks as it does not dry out or irritate my skin.

Overall I’ve had a great experience with this product.
